Of course! Toronto is the capital city of the province of Ontario and is the largest city in Canada. It's a major economic, cultural, and political hub within the country. Here are some key facts about Toronto:
Location: Toronto is situated in southeastern Ontario, on the northwestern shore of Lake Ontario. It's relatively close to the Canada-U.S. border.
Population: Toronto is one of the most populous cities in North America, with a diverse population representing a wide range of cultures and ethnicities.
Economy: The city has a strong and diverse economy, with sectors such as finance, technology, film production, healthcare, education, and more contributing to its economic growth.
Landmarks: Toronto is known for its iconic landmarks, including the CN Tower, which was once the world's tallest free-standing structure. The Toronto Islands, Royal Ontario Museum, Ripley's Aquarium of Canada, and the Art Gallery of Ontario are also popular attractions.
Cultural Diversity: Toronto is often celebrated for its cultural diversity, with numerous neighborhoods showcasing the city's multicultural nature. Chinatown, Little Italy, Little India, and Greektown are just a few examples.
Arts and Entertainment: The city hosts a variety of cultural events, festivals, theaters, and live music venues. The Toronto International Film Festival (TIFF) is a prominent annual event that attracts international attention.
Sports: Toronto is home to several professional sports teams, including the Toronto Raptors (NBA), Toronto Maple Leafs (NHL), Toronto Blue Jays (MLB), and Toronto FC (MLS).
Education: The city has several esteemed universities, including the University of Toronto, Ryerson University, and York University.
Green Spaces: Toronto offers numerous parks and green spaces, such as High Park and Queen's Park, providing residents and visitors with recreational opportunities.
Public Transportation: Toronto has an extensive public transportation system, including buses, streetcars, and a subway system, making it relatively easy to get around the city.
